I noticed that many people are talking about schools emailing them saying that they are "complete." Does going complete at the school different from when LSAC says you're complete?
Re: Going complete (LSAC vs. School)?
Posted: Wed Oct 27, 2010 9:31 pm
by Bumi
When an application is complete at LSAC, that just means they transmitted out your info. But for an application to go complete at the school, they have to have received everything, including any forms they need you to mail them, and that they've processed it.
Some schools get everything sent to them electronically and can mark applications complete the day you apply, but some schools get the LSAC information mailed to them physically which can take freaking forever.
